How to Create Keywords - Part II

Search engine optimization (SEO) is one of the most important aspects of any website. SEO corresponds directly with ranking on the major search engines, which is how people find your site and therefore, your product or service. Part of creating a higher ranking on the search engines has to do with creating keywords. Keywords are the terms or phrases that people generally search when looking for sites in your industry. For example, if you run a florist business, one of your keywords would obviously be "flowers", since you want your site to show up whenever people search under the word "flowers". However, this may be unrealistic due to the daunting level of competition for the term "flowers".

The process of creating keywords can be tricky. After all, many people search for certain phrases versus just one word to get specific results. The best way to create keywords for your site that will put you in the line of search for the audience you are targeting is to think creatively about creating them.

When you think about how to create keywords, not only should you think about whom you are a targeting, but also about the need you are trying to fulfill. Your site should feature words that directly correspond to the services or product you offer. You should also consider how you think people might search for whatever it is you are featuring on your site. Think abstractly and remember that there should be a fair amount of these words in the content on your site.

There are many tools that can be used that will help you create a keyword list. You need to analyze a few pieces of data to determine the best keywords. First, look at the traffic to each keyword and the number of websites that are using the keyword. This will help you determine if it is realistic to optimize your website for the term you selected. Then look at the websites that are using the keywords. Is the website that is using the keyword you would like a more relevant site to the search engines then yours? At this point you need to compare your website to the competition. For example, how many inbounds links do they have? How relevant are the links to the keywords they are optimizing for? How many pages is there website? How long has the website been active? How is the website coded?

In many instances, business owners work closely with SEO companies to help them determine the best search terms and keywords for their business category and then develop content around those words and terms. Whether you do it yourself or work with a professional SEO specialist, thinking about how to create keywords and implementing a plan of action is the best way to ensure that your page gets top ranking in the search engines. Moreover, a higher ranking will ensure that the public is better aware of what you have to offer, giving your business a great chance at online success.
